Seasonal variations of bedding site characteristics of Gazella subgutturosa in Kalamaili Mountain Nature Reserve.

Abstract: In 2007, an investigation was made on the seasonal variations of the bedding site characteristics of Goitred gazelle (Gazella subgutturosa) in Kalamaili Mountain Nature Reserve. Mann-Whitney U test, Kolmogorov-Smirnov Z test, Kruskal-Wallis test, one way ANOVA and principal component (PCA) analysis were used for the multivariate analysis of variables. In the bedding site, the vegetation height, Ceratoides latens density, shrub coverage, and ground biomass in spring, the vegetation height and ground biomass per unit area in summer, and the vegetation height, shrub coverage, and species richness in autumn were significantly higher than those in the random plots. Principal component analysis showed that the key environment factors determining the selection of bedding site by G. subgutturosa in spring, autumn, and winter were food, concealment, and temperature. Analysis of one way ANOVA showed that there existed significant differences in the bedding site characteristics among the three seasons, especially between spring and summer, and between spring and autumn. The variations of food resources and environment temperature were the major factors inducing the seasonal variations of the bedding site characteristics, and the bedding site selection of G. subgutturosa had some relationships with its own thermoregulation.
